    The SAP error message TK655 ("Specify at least one request status") typically occurs in the context of transport requests in the SAP system. This error indicates that when you are trying to display or manage transport requests, you have not specified any request status, which is required for the operation you are attempting to perform.
    
    Cause: The error is caused by the absence of a specified request status when executing a transaction related to transport requests. This can happen in various scenarios, such as: Trying to view or manage transport requests without selecting any status (e.g., released, modifiable, etc.). Incorrect or incomplete input in the selection criteria for transport requests.
    Solution: To resolve the TK655 error, you should: Specify Request Status: When prompted, ensure that you select at least one request status. Common statuses include: Released Modifiable Completed In Process Not Released Check Input Fields: Make sure that all required fields in the selection screen are filled out correctly.
